Assalamualaikum halo semua apa kabar nih? semoga selalu sehat yaa, ppada kesempatan kali ini saya ingin menjelaskan cara konfigurasi juga install database pada debian 12, yuu simak baik-baik yaaa
Pengertian Database Server
Database adalah sistem penyimpanan yang terorganisir untuk mengelola data. Ini memungkinkan pengguna untuk menyimpan, mencari, dan mengolah informasi dengan mudah. Misalnya, dalam database relasional, data disimpan dalam tabel yang terhubung, sedangkan database NoSQL lebih fleksibel untuk data yang tidak terstruktur. Penggunaan database sangat luas, dari aplikasi bisnis hingga platform online.
Fungsi Database Server
- Penyimpanan Data : Database server menyimpan data dalam format terstruktur.Sehingga memudahkan pengorganisasian dan pengelolaan data.
- Keamanan : Database server mengelola akses pengguna dengan sistem autentikasi dan otorisasi. Ini memastikan hanya pengguna yang berwenang yang dapat mengakses atau mengubah data.
- Pengolahan Permintaan : Ketika aplikasi atau pengguna mengajukan kueri (permintaan untuk mengambil atau memanipulasi data), database server memproses kueri tersebut dan mengembalikan hasilnya. Ini dilakukan dengan menggunakan bahasa query, seperti SQL.
- Cadangan dan Pemulihan : Database server menyediakan mekanisme untuk mencadangkan data secara rutin, sehingga jika terjadi kehilangan data akibat kerusakan atau kesalahan, data dapat dipulihkan dengan mudah.
- Kinerja dan Optimasi : Database server mengoptimalkan kinerja dengan teknik seperti caching, indeksasi, dan pengaturan sumber daya, sehingga kueri dapat dijalankan dengan cepat.
- Multi-User Access : Database server memungkinkan banyak pengguna dan aplikasi untuk mengakses data secara bersamaan, dengan menjaga integritas data.
- Transaksi : Database server mendukung transaksi, yang merupakan serangkaian operasi yang harus dilakukan secara keseluruhan. Jika satu bagian gagal, seluruh transaksi dibatalkan, menjaga konsistensi data.
Jenis Database Server
- Database Relasional : Mengorganisir data dalam tabel dengan hubungan antar tabel, menggunakan SQL. Contoh: MySQL, PostgreSQL.
- Database NoSQL : Dirancang untuk menangani data tidak terstruktur, sering kali lebih fleksibel. Contoh: MongoDB, Cassandra.
- Database Berbasis Cloud : Menyediakan penyimpanan data yang diakses melalui internet. Contoh: Amazon RDS, Google Cloud Firestore.
- Database Graf : Menggunakan struktur graf untuk menghubungkan data, cocok untuk hubungan yang kompleks. Contoh: Neo4j.
- Database Hierarkis : Mengorganisir data dalam struktur pohon, dengan hubungan induk-anak. Contoh: IBM Information Management System (IMS).
- Database Objek : Menyimpan data dalam format objek, cocok untuk aplikasi yang berbasis objek. Contoh: db4o.
Cara Kerja Database Server
- Penyimpanan Data: Data disimpan dalam struktur terorganisir, seperti tabel atau dokumen, tergantung pada jenis database.
- Query: Pengguna atau aplikasi mengajukan permintaan (kueri) untuk mengakses atau memanipulasi data, biasanya menggunakan bahasa query seperti SQL.
- Pengolahan Kueri: Database server memproses kueri, melakukan pencarian, penghitungan, atau perubahan sesuai permintaan.
- Pengembalian Hasil: Setelah memproses kueri, database server mengembalikan hasilnya kepada pengguna atau aplikasi.
- Keamanan dan Transaksi: Selama proses ini, database juga mengelola keamanan dan memastikan transaksi dijalankan secara konsisten.
Kelebihan Database Server
- Penyimpanan terstruktur yang memudahkan akses.
- Kontrol akses untuk melindungi data.
- Menjaga akurasi dan konsistensi.
- Banyak pengguna dapat mengakses data sekaligus.
- Fasilitas untuk mencadangkan dan memulihkan data.
- Mudah ditingkatkan untuk menampung lebih banyak data atau pengguna.
- Menjamin keamanan dan konsistensi data.
Kekurangan database
- Pengadaan dan pemeliharaan yang mahal.
- Memerlukan pengetahuan teknis untuk pengelolaan.
- Proses pembuatan yang memakan waktu.
- Kinerja bisa menurun pada database besar.
- Rentan terhadap serangan siber jika tidak dikelola baik.
- Perubahan teknologi bisa mempengaruhi sistem.
Tidak ada komentar:
Posting Komentar